Default Rearend noise

My stock 10 bolt with 3.23`s that has never been opened has started making a whining noise. It sounds like a 4 wheel drive going down the road. It gets louder the faster you go. Tires have about 1000 miles on them since the last rotation. I`m not ruling out the tires, but I find it hard to believe they are making the noise. The car only has 25,000 miles on it and I wasn`t doing anything to cause any damage to the rearend. I just checked the fluid a couple months ago and it was full. It sits in my garage most of the time and there isn`t any oil on the floor. Any ideas?

Hi Folks
mine started to whine and I pulled the rear end to find the pinion gear had a couple of teeth cracked which still does not make sense why. The teeth that has cracks, it was at the toe of the gear and not in the area that makes contact with the the ring gear. If I did not take it apart and fix it, it would have come a part and really screwed up my rear end.

Whine is usually gear sound. The pinion bearing can make similar sounds, but bearings usually make a kinda humming sound. Mine sounds like mud tires or a tire out of balance. I`m going to pull the axles. I believe one of them is wearing due to lack of oil getting to the axle bearings.

Hi Folks
After looking at my pinion gear, I found more cracks. It looks like four teeth were ready to come off - there are fine cracks at the other end of the gear. Under pressure the gears were making a real funny sound - like the gears were separating from it. Don't wait, pull the gears now and inspect them - like I say the ring does not have any damage.
